What is an International Primary School? 

International primary schools are educational institutions that provide a global curriculum and a diverse community of students from different cultural backgrounds. They are designed to prepare students for a globalized world and equip them with the necessary skills to succeed in a multicultural environment. Unlike traditional schools, international primary schools offer a global curriculum that focuses on a wide range of subjects and is based on international standards. This curriculum is designed to develop critical thinking, problem-solving, creativity, and innovation, which are essential skills for success in the 21st century.

Global Curriculum 

International primary schools often follow an international curriculum that focuses on global issues, such as sustainability, peace, and justice. This curriculum prepares students for a world that is increasingly interconnected and helps them develop a global perspective. 

International School of Nanshan Shenzhen, for example, is authorized as an IB World School and offers the International Baccalaureate (IB) Primary Years Programme (PYP). The PYP has been developed for students ages 3-12 years old and uses a transdisciplinary, inquiry-based approach that focuses on developing the whole child. The curriculum is designed to foster critical thinking, creativity, and communication skills, while also promoting cultural understanding and global citizenship.

Language Acquisition 

Many international primary schools offer bilingual or multilingual education, which can help children acquire new languages and develop their communication skills. Learning a new language at a young age can also enhance cognitive development, improve memory, and boost creativity. 

At International School of Nanshan Shenzhen, the school offers a bilingual immersion program in English and Mandarin Chinese. This program provides students with the opportunity to develop fluency in both languages, preparing them for success in a globalized world.
